San Jose,
CA - Today V Communications announced that DriveWorks, a
wizard driven integrated solution for hard drive management including
partitioning, copying, imaging and backing up hard drives, is shipping
now. This "first of its kind" suite combines V Communications'
well-known Partition Commander® with their new Copy Commander,
Image Commander and SecurErase. As a bonus, AutoSave,
has also been included into this value packed software suite for
just $69.95

Each of the
products included in the DriveWorks suite performs a wide variety
of management tasks. Partition Commander, often recognized as the
easiest, most powerful partitioning product available, provides
the ability to safely resize partitions, with no risk to data. Hard
drives become better organized, wasted disk space can be reclaimed
and in some cases, system speed may improve as well. Partition Commander
provides safe resize for Windows® 95/98/Me/NT/2000, DOS and
Linux. Also provided is the ability to convert partitions from FAT16
to FAT32, or FAT32 to FAT16, or NTFS to FAT, including NTFS compressed
volumes. With the exclusive BackStep Wizard, multiple partitioning
operations can be undone at a later time including the recovery
of a deleted partition.
DriveWorks includes Image Commander, which provides complete hard
drive backup by making an exact duplicate "image" of a
partition or an entire hard drive. Image Commander creates a compressed
image file that can be easily saved to a CD, Zip, Jaz,
to another hard drive or network drive. Should a system crash occur,
this easy-to-use, wizard-driven imaging solution provides restoration
to a prior state when the system worked correctly. DriveWorks' Copy
Commander provides the safest and easiest way to automatically transfer
everything from an old hard drive to a new hard drive without missing
any preferences, settings or data. There is no need to reinstall
anything. Copy Commander supports all PC operating systems and their
file systems. Copy Commander even copies multiple partitions and
gives the option to have them proportionally expanded on the new
disk. To round out the DriveWorks suite, SecurErase completely eliminates
the possibility of recovery for deleted files or partitions, something
even re-formatting a hard drive cannot promise. SecurErase provides
a multi-pass drive/partition erase for total peace of mind.
As a bonus,
DriveWorks also includes AutoSave, the award-winning, automatic
backup program that works as the user does. Running in the background
under Windows 95/98/Me/NT and 2000, it automatically and invisibly
backs up files that are created and modified as the user works on
them. A perfect compliment to Image Commander, which takes care
of periodic full backups, AutoSave concentrates only on those files
created and worked with between those full backups.
DriveWorks'
minimum configuration is 386/486/Pentium or better and it requires
8 MB RAM. DriveWorks works with all hard drives including those
40 GB or larger, and can be run directly from an included boot diskette
or bootable CD-ROM or can be installed and run from Windows 95/98/Me.
